The items you are storing

This factor concerns points 3, 6, and possibly 4. If you are storing some delicate goods that are prone to weather and temperature damage, you will need to look for climate-controlled storage units. That is the only way to keep them safe from any harm and ensure their intact condition. With that in mind, the importance the distance plays in your decision may diminish a bit. In addition, if those delicate goods are also high in value (music instruments, art pieces, etc.), you probably want to see to it that the company offers some good valuation policy options.

Musical insturments in a room
The differences between good and bad storage are not the same for your musical instruments and your bedsheets.

Whether you need to rent short or long term storage also plays a big role in determining whether the storage option is good or bad for you. If you are renovating your home, and want to leave the goods just from the kitchen you are refurbishing, you will probably opt for short term storage. However, if you don’t know what to do with your stationary bike, and know that riding it is not in the foreseeable future, your best option is to go for long term storage.

How to know what is good and what is bad storage for you in particular?

As you can see, it is not only one factor that will make or break a case of a good storage unit. It is an individual decision. With that said, how would you make it? Well, sit down, take a pen and a piece of paper, and write it all down. Which items do you plan on storing, how long for, and how frequently do you plan on visiting them? Do they require any special attention or are they just fine in a simple warehouse? Safety is always the number one concern, and you want to make sure your goods greet you the same way you left them. After that, it is up to you to decide whether you are willing to pay more for a unit that is closer or are fine with saving a bit on storage that is further out of town.
